March 2011 U.S. Catfish Feed Deliveries Up 29 Percent from Last Year

Total catfish feed delivered in the United States during March 2011 was 17,459 tons, up 29 percent from March 2010 and up 252 percent from the previous month. Foodsize catfish feed delivered totaled 16,891 tons, up
33 percent from the corresponding month a year ago. Feed delivered for fingerlings and broodfish totaled 568 tons, down 37 percent from the corresponding month a year ago.

March feed delivered to Alabama catfish growers for foodsize fish totaled 6,951 tons, up 100 percent from last year. Alabama accounted for 41 percent of the total foodsize catfish feed delivered to United States farmers.

The other major States with catfish feed deliveries for foodsize fish in March and their comparison to the previous year were Arkansas with 1,431 tons, up 2 percent; Louisiana with 298 tons, up 4 percent; and Mississippi with 5,446 tons, up 20 percent.
